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Hedwig Village Apartments

How much is rent for a Cheap One Bedroom Hedwig Village Apartment?

The lowest price for a Cheap One Bedroom Hedwig Village Apartment is $633 at Cedar Branch Apartments.

What is the lowest price for a Cheap Two Bedroom Hedwig Village Apartment for rent?

Today's best deal for a Cheap Two Bedroom Apartment in Hedwig Village is starting from $859 at Cedar Branch Apartments.

What is the most affordable Hedwig Village Three Bedroom Apartment?

The best deal on a cheap Hedwig Village Three Bedroom Apartment rental is at Gessner Park Apartments and starts from $1,199.
